Skip to content

Commit 684f08c

Browse files
authored
Fix slither CI issues in OpenZeppelin Community (#17)
1 parent fa78517 commit 684f08c

1 file changed

Lines changed: 7 additions & 7 deletions

File tree

packages/contracts/src/utils/JwtRegistry.sol

Lines changed: 7 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-15,7 +15,7 @@ import {StringToArrayUtils} from "./StringToArrayUtils.sol";
1515
contract JwtRegistry is IDKIMRegistry, Ownable {
1616
using StringToArrayUtils for string;
1717

18-
DKIMRegistry public dkimRegistry;
18+
DKIMRegistry public immutable dkimRegistry;
1919

2020
// Check if azp is registered
2121
mapping(string => bool) public whitelistedClients;
@@ -48,7 +48,7 @@ contract JwtRegistry is IDKIMRegistry, Ownable {
4848
string memory domainName,
4949
bytes32 publicKeyHash
5050
) public view returns (bool) {
51-
return this.isDKIMPublicKeyHashValid(domainName, publicKeyHash);
51+
return isDKIMPublicKeyHashValid(domainName, publicKeyHash);
5252
}
5353

5454
/// @notice Sets a public key hash for a `kis|iss` string after validating the provided signature.
@@ -64,17 +64,17 @@ contract JwtRegistry is IDKIMRegistry, Ownable {
6464
string[] memory parts = domainName.stringToArray();
6565
string memory kidAndIss = string(abi.encode(parts[0], "|", parts[1]));
6666
require(
67-
isDKIMPublicKeyHashValid(domainName, publicKeyHash) == false,
67+
!isDKIMPublicKeyHashValid(domainName, publicKeyHash),
6868
"publicKeyHash is already set"
6969
);
7070
require(
71-
dkimRegistry.revokedDKIMPublicKeyHashes(publicKeyHash) == false,
71+
!dkimRegistry.revokedDKIMPublicKeyHashes(publicKeyHash),
7272
"publicKeyHash is revoked"
7373
);
7474

75-
dkimRegistry.setDKIMPublicKeyHash(kidAndIss, publicKeyHash);
7675
// Register azp
7776
whitelistedClients[parts[2]] = true;
77+
dkimRegistry.setDKIMPublicKeyHash(kidAndIss, publicKeyHash);
7878
}
7979

8080
/// @notice Revokes a public key hash for `kis|iss` string after validating the provided signature.
@@ -88,11 +88,11 @@ contract JwtRegistry is IDKIMRegistry, Ownable {
8888
require(bytes(domainName).length != 0, "Invalid domain name");
8989
require(publicKeyHash != bytes32(0), "Invalid public key hash");
9090
require(
91-
isDKIMPublicKeyHashValid(domainName, publicKeyHash) == true,
91+
isDKIMPublicKeyHashValid(domainName, publicKeyHash),
9292
"publicKeyHash is not set"
9393
);
9494
require(
95-
dkimRegistry.revokedDKIMPublicKeyHashes(publicKeyHash) == false,
95+
!dkimRegistry.revokedDKIMPublicKeyHashes(publicKeyHash),
9696
"publicKeyHash is already revoked"
9797
);
9898

0 commit comments

Comments
 (0)